Brutal corrugation concerns me greatly... how long were these section in terms of the total route?

I did the Chameleon Brewery ride which shares a lot of the same route. We encountered around 6km of corrugated roads so my guess is that on RTTS you'll have 6-10km of speed bumps.

 

All straight district roads so I would drop my pressure to 1.2 - 1.4 to cater for corrugation (even on a dual sus)
